Hebrew Strong's Lexicon

H702

Language: 🇧🇶 Papiamentu 🇬🇧 English

Lemma: אַרְבַּע

Transliteration: ar-bah'

Definition: masculine oarbaah; from רָבַע; four

KJV Definition: four
